Subject: Canary gating cut-over done

Welcome aboard, and a quick note: as of last night, the Wrenfall deploy pipeline enforces the new canary gating rules. Releases now hold at 5% traffic until error-rate and latency checks pass two consecutive windows, then ramp automatically. Manual promotion is gone. The gating thresholds the pipeline evaluates against are listed below.

deployment values, faduf-tawep:
SORDOR_LOG_LEVEL=error
SORDOR_METRICS_HOST=metrics.sordor.nelvrolabs.internal
SORDOR_POOL_SIZE=4

// RATE_PARITY_SCAN_INTERVAL_MS
//
// Scan cadence for the Quillhaven rate-parity checker.
// Security note: shorter intervals increase outbound request
// volume to partner rate feeds and may trip their abuse
// throttles. Interval changes require sign-off. Credentials
// for feed access are injected at deploy time, never stored
// here. Lower bound enforced at startup. The reviewed build
// corresponds to the token below.

pipeline stamp: htk9_6ce9d33c5

Action item from the Mirewater tide-table widget incident. Owner: release manager. Widget cached stale harbor offsets after the DST change, showing tides six hours off for two days. Required: add a cache-invalidation check to the release checklist, block deploys when offset tables are older than 24 hours, and verify the Saltgate harbor feed before each cut. Deadline: next release. Checklist template and sign-off procedure are documented on the internal page below.

wiki page, kawif-bajep: https://artifactory.zarqelforge.internal/issue/browse/display/display/projects/spaces/secrets/000fe6ec5a46af29355003e1

## Dedup runbook: when alerts pile up anyway

If Quenchpipe is letting duplicate pages through, the usual culprit is a plugin emitting alerts with unstable fingerprints. Check that your plugin sets a deterministic dedup key before blaming the core. Restarting the deduplicator clears the fingerprint window, so only do that as a last resort. For debugging, spin up a local instance using the settings below.

service settings:
[druvan]
port = 8000
team = gorir
host = druvan.paliqworks.corp
region = central-1
access_code = ac_0d333e
timeout_ms = 1000